How much do manufacturing associ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for manufacturing associate in Pittsboro, MS is $16.28,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.79 and $18.22 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a manufacturing associate?

A manufacturing associate assists in the operations of a manufacturing facility and the products that it produces. As a manufacturing associate, your job duties include organizing supplies and raw materials inventory, preparing equipment, and training staff with preparation and production. You may also investigate the manufacturing process to fix any issues and ensure it meets strict regulations. The qualifications for a career as a manufacturing associate typically include a bachelor’s degree and prior manufacturing experience in a similar industry. You also need computer proficiency, as the job may require daily use of multiple software applications, along with mechanical skills to handle a variety of manufacturing tools and equipment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manufacturing associ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manufacturing Associate, you need a solid understanding of production processes, attention to detail,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with manufacturing equipment, quality control systems, and safety protocols is typically required, and some roles may prefer certifications like OSHA training. Strong teamwork, problem-solving, and communication skills help individuals excel in fast-paced, collaborative environments. These abilities ensure efficient production, uphold safety standards, and contribute to consistent product quality.

What are some common challenges manufacturing associates face, and how can they be addressed?

Manufacturing Associates often encounter challenges such as maintaining consistent quality under tight deadlines, adapting to rapidly changing production schedules, and ensuring safety in a fast-paced environment. Staying organized, following standardized operating procedures, and communicating effectively with team members can help address these issues. It's also beneficial to actively participate in training programs to stay updated on best practices and safety guidelines, which not only improves performance but can open doors to advancement opportunities within the organization.

What is the difference between Manufacturing Associate vs Production Technician?

AspectManufacturing AssociateProduction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certificationsHigh school diploma; technical certifications may be preferred
Work EnvironmentFactories, production lines, manufacturing plantsFactories, production areas, equipment operation
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ing companies, assembly plantsManufacturing, industrial facilities, production units
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Manufacturing Associates and Production Technicians both work in manufacturing environments, often performing similar tasks such as assembling products, operating machinery, and ensuring quality. The main differences lie in certifications and technical skills; Production Technicians typically require more technical training or certifications and may handle more complex equipment. Both roles are essential in the manufacturing industry and often overlap in daily responsibilities.
